which flag is this wtf?
tatar
Tatarstan
tatar peoples flag
The Republic of Tatarstan, or simply Tatarstan, is a republic of Russia located in Eastern Europe. It is a part of the Volga Federal District; and its capital and largest city is Kazan, one of the most important cultural centres of Russia.